Bolsonarism
Bolsonarism () is an ideology or the political movement tied to Jair Bolsonaro. His views, policies, and supporters are variously described as neo-fascist or far-right populism by scholars and news outlets, although Bolsonaro denied that he is a fascist. Bolsonarism broke out in Brazil with the rise in popularity of Bolsonaro, especially during his campaign in the presidential election in 2018, which elected him as president. Case Covaxin
The Case Covaxin, also known as Covaxgate, refers to an investigation made by the Brazilian Federal Public Ministry (MPF), held on 16 June 2021, which found evidence of irregularities in the purchase of 20 million doses by the Ministry of Health of the Indian vaccine Covaxin, with the value of the vaccines 1000% higher than initially foreseen.
